Let's be the leader in the retail industry. On July 2, 1962, Sam Walton opened his first Wal-Mart Discount Store in Rogers. Seven years later, he was founded as a Wal - Mart store. In the 1970s the company began trading shares in the OTC market and in 1972 Wal-Mart was listed on the New York Stock Exchange. . Today, Wal-Mart has become the world's largest enterprise company, including Wal-Mart store in USA, Wal-Mart discount store, Wal-Mart super mall, neighboring market and so on.
